The woman was at home on Friday afternoon when two men in balaclavas broke in.
A woman has been left 'devastated and traumatised' after two men in balaclavas broke into her home and held her there while they stole belongings worth thousands of pounds.
The two men wearing balaclavas ransacked the house, stealing property valued in the thousands of pounds. Luckily, the woman was not injured. Officers are appealing for information about the incident and are keen to hear from anyone who saw any suspicious vehicles in the area around that time.
